Bulk Salt Usage: None; DOT Cost: Not ApplicableSalt in thick underground layers is known as rock salt. The thickest and most extensive salt layer in Kansas is the geologic formation known as the Hutchinson Salt Member, which underlies approximately 37,000 square miles of central Kansas. About 500 to 1,000 feet deep in much of Kansas, it is, on average, 250 feet thick. The rock salt in ... An inland salt marsh is a saltwater marsh located away from the coast. Salt was found in the central portion of the state and has been the source of another important sector of the Kansas economy. These salt deposits resulted from the time period when most of central Kansas was a vast inland sea (Permian Sea). Counties where mining occurred or still occurs are Reno, Rice, Ellsworth, and Kingman.

Ghadan Company International Trade and Development New Damietta, DamiettaDuring the early days of the salt-producing industry in Kansas, two mines were in operation at Kingman. The first mine began operation in 1889 but closed about 2 years later. A second mine was opened shortly thereafter but ceased operation in 1893. Huge salt reserves are present but salt is not being produced in the county.The Kansas Soybean Commission, Hutchinson Salt Company and National Biodiesel Board (NBB) hosted a tour of the salt company's mine in Hutchinson, Kan., on Dec. 22.
